Polished Concrete in Data Centers Isn't Just a Finish. It's a System.
Mission-critical facilities host sensitive, high-value equipment that operates around the clock. While power, cooling, and connectivity often take center stage, flooring is a critical — but sometimes overlooked — foundation for long-term reliability and performance.
Data center floors take a beating. Rolling rack traffic, sensitive equipment overhead, phased turnover schedules, follow-on trades — the floor must perform from day one and keep performing for years. That means dust-free surfaces, durable joints, and a finish that holds up under ongoing operations without adding to your maintenance burden.
Getting there requires more than running a grinder across the slab. Concrete polishing at this level is process-driven, tooling-specific, and chemistry-dependent. The sequencing matters. The slab conditions matter. Skip a step or use the wrong tooling, and you're looking at callbacks, premature wear, or joint failures — none of which you want on a mission-critical turnover.
